ROLE PURPOSE
Accountable for the provision of specialist knowledge, delivery plans and associated practices of clinical data requirements through the extraction, analysis, validation and modelling of data with the purpose of drawing conclusions to drive clinical and operational decision making within the Scheme
Key Areas of Responsibility
- Establish working relationships with the business areas to identify gaps and business needs, and analyse and improve where required through the use of key data gathering, analysis and inferences.
- Develop and implement a framework of databases, data collection systems, data analytics dashboards and other strategies that optimise statistical efficiency and quality to inform key business decisions.
- Collate information in a meaningful way, from primary or secondary data sources (third party providers) for the purpose of analysis.
- Act as gatekeeper for data, managing data integrity and ensuring data is accurate before analysis and reporting.
- Provide accurate organisational analytics in a number of formats including dashboards, graphs, charts and reports.
- Develop analytical models that manage data intelligently in order to generate insightful information and identify trends and patterns in complex data sets.
- Develop user-friendly and accurate reports to monitor application of Scheme Rules and identify trends for high cost driver areas.
- Analyse, integrate and manage data with current and planned data systems.
- Create and interpret reports to determine return on investment of the respective managed healthcare provider.
- Lead clinical data management studies to announce protocols to effect relevant cost savings.
- Keep informed of best practice and technological developments in order to recognise improvement opportunities and articulate the potential benefits these could bring to the Scheme.
- Develop and implement specific procedures to give input into product design and specific cost containment exercises.
- Develop, review and maintain the hospital discount calculation model and ensure that payment of hospital discount is received from the hospital networks and collected quarterly.
- Monitor data base statistics for completeness and accuracy.
